Intellectual Property at UC Davis

This course aims to explain why IP language in research agreements is important and can have implications lasting after the research project is concluded.

Course Description

Last year alone:

  • UC Davis received over $750 Million in research funding from external sources;
  • Over 180 new inventions were reported to InnovationAccess by UCD inventors; and
  • UC Davis generated over $11 Million in licensing income from patent rights.

The Sponsored Programs and InnovationAccess Offices within the Office of Research work together to support the continuum of innovation at our campus – from developing a new research project with a sponsor to protecting new inventions and transferring technologies to industry partners for commercializing in the marketplace.

This course will explain your rights, as a UC employee, under UC Patent Policy, and will detail the technology transfer process for new inventions.
